What does the map indicate about the effect of nationalism in Austria-Hungary?

I would say the correct answer is D. Austria-Hungary would no longer exist if every ethnic group got its own independent territory.
As you can see, Austria-Hungary consisted of many ethnic groups at the time, including Germans, Poles, Slovenes, etc. What this meant for the nationalism is that each of these ethnic groups wanted their independence and to separate from Austria-Hungary. And if they did that, there would no longer be Austria-Hungary, but rather a bunch of new countries in Europe.

Why did thousands of protesters gather in Grant Park near the site of the 1968 Democratic National Convention in Chicago?
Artemon [7]

Answer:

to garner public support for ending the war in Vietnam.

Explanation:

In 1967, counterculture and anti-Vietnam War protest groups had been promising to come to Chicago and disrupt the convention, and the city promised to maintain law and order. For eight days the protesters were met by the Chicago Police Department in the streets and parks of Chicago while the U.S. Democratic Party met at the convention in the International Amphitheater, with the protests climaxing in what a major report later said was a "police riot" on the night of August 28, 1968.
